cardiovascular

[ kahr-dee-oh-vas-kyuh-ler ]

adjectiveAnatomy.
  1. of, relating to, or affecting the heart and blood vessels.

Origin of cardiovascular

1
First recorded in 1875–80; cardio- + vascular
